Hikaru Sulu

Everybody knows about Chuck Norris Facts—seemingly absurd (though accurate) statements about Chuck Norris. Less well known are similarly true facts about Hikaru Sulu, astrobiologist, helmsman of the USS Enterprise, and later captain of the USS Excelsior.

In the Star Trek on-screen canon, Sulu is established as an avid botanist, expert swordsman, judo practitioner, and expert in antique Earth weapons (including firearms). Additionally, he was knowledgeable about ancient Earth vehicles and was able to fly a helicopter that had been built hundreds of years before he was born.

Just don’t call him ‘tiny.’
